Output 531c6170691b8661b615a545294e3c6167f87ef030a3e369f5de7c1b29bc4539:0

value
319418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b044dda500784c8887f2a69a9876826006e89c OP_EQUAL
address
3Bbi4eTwzkVQm4gGLmeGEjJ6RSMyZCLRXc
transaction
531c6170691b8661b615a545294e3c6167f87ef030a3e369f5de7c1b29bc4539
confirmations
299136
spent
true